Understanding Inflammation: The Body’s Silent Fire
Inflammation is a natural process – the body’s defense mechanism against injury and infection. When your body detects harm, it releases chemicals that trigger an immune response. This response aims to heal and protect you. However, when inflammation becomes chronic, it can contribute to a range of health problems, including arthritis, heart disease, diabetes, and even certain cancers.
Inflammation manifests in several ways. Acute inflammation, like the swelling and redness around a cut, is short-lived and beneficial. Chronic inflammation, on the other hand, persists for months or years, often without obvious symptoms. This insidious form of inflammation is driven by factors like diet, lifestyle, stress, and environmental toxins.

The Potential Anti-Inflammatory Benefits of Certain Cheeses
While cheese is often perceived as a pro-inflammatory food, some varieties contain compounds that may contribute to an anti-inflammatory response. These compounds include conjugated linoleic acid (CLA), probiotics, and certain fatty acids.
Conjugated Linoleic Acid (CLA): A Powerful Antioxidant
CLA is a type of fatty acid found in dairy products, particularly in grass-fed animals. Studies have suggested that CLA may have anti-inflammatory properties, potentially reducing inflammation markers in the body. It’s thought to work by modulating the immune system and reducing the production of inflammatory molecules. Cheese made from the milk of grass-fed cows, such as some varieties of cheddar and Gouda, may contain higher levels of CLA.
Probiotics: Gut Health and Inflammation
The gut microbiome plays a significant role in overall health, including inflammation. An imbalance in gut bacteria can contribute to chronic inflammation. Some cheeses, particularly those that are aged or unpasteurized, contain probiotics, beneficial bacteria that can support a healthy gut microbiome. These probiotics can help reduce inflammation by improving gut barrier function and modulating the immune response. Examples include certain raw milk cheeses like some artisanal cheddars and Gruyere, although it’s important to ensure these cheeses are sourced from reputable producers with strict hygiene standards.
Fatty Acid Profile: Omega-3s and Saturated Fats
The type of fat in cheese also influences its inflammatory potential. While cheese is high in saturated fat, research suggests that not all saturated fats are created equal. Some saturated fats, particularly those found in dairy, may have neutral or even beneficial effects on inflammation. Additionally, cheeses made from grass-fed animals may contain higher levels of omega-3 fatty acids, known for their anti-inflammatory properties.

Debunking Cheese Myths: Separating Fact from Fiction
Many misconceptions surround cheese and its impact on health. Let’s address some common myths:
- Myth: All cheese is high in saturated fat and therefore pro-inflammatory. While cheese does contain saturated fat, the type and quantity of fat can vary significantly. Furthermore, recent research suggests that the saturated fat in dairy may not be as detrimental as previously thought.
- Myth: Cheese causes weight gain. Cheese can be part of a healthy diet and does not automatically lead to weight gain. Portion control and overall dietary balance are crucial factors.
- Myth: People with lactose intolerance cannot eat any cheese. Many aged cheeses have lower lactose content and may be tolerated by individuals with lactose intolerance. Hard cheeses like cheddar and Parmesan are often better tolerated than soft cheeses like Brie.
- Myth: All processed cheese is bad for you. While highly processed cheeses should be avoided, some minimally processed cheeses can be part of a healthy diet. Focus on whole, unprocessed cheeses whenever possible.

How does the fat content of cheese affect its potential anti-inflammatory properties?
The type of fat present in cheese, rather than simply the amount, appears to be a more significant factor in its potential anti-inflammatory properties. Cheeses derived from grass-fed animals are generally higher in Omega-3 fatty acids and conjugated linoleic acid (CLA), both of which are associated with reduced inflammation. These beneficial fats can help balance the ratio of Omega-6 to Omega-3 fatty acids in the body, which is crucial for managing inflammation.
While high-fat cheeses might seem inherently unhealthy, their fat content provides a vehicle for delivering these potentially beneficial fatty acids. Conversely, low-fat cheeses may lack these important components and could even contain higher levels of processed ingredients to compensate for the reduced fat, potentially increasing inflammation. Consider the source and production methods more than just the overall fat percentage.

How does lactose content in cheese impact its inflammatory potential?
Lactose intolerance can trigger inflammation in susceptible individuals, making the lactose content of cheese a key consideration. When lactose is not properly digested, it can lead to bloating, gas, and other digestive discomforts that contribute to inflammation in the gut. For individuals with lactose intolerance, high-lactose cheeses can exacerbate inflammatory responses.
However, many cheeses, particularly aged varieties like cheddar or Parmesan, naturally contain very little lactose due to the fermentation process. During aging, bacteria consume the lactose, reducing its concentration to negligible levels. Therefore, choosing aged cheeses can be a viable option for those with lactose intolerance who are seeking to minimize inflammation.
